The present invention generally relates to a system and method for implementing a scratch-off (“instant”) lottery ticket game, and more particularly to a method and system for facilitating multi-lingual play of such games.
“Scratch-off” or “instant-win” lottery tickets have enjoyed immense popularity in the lottery industry for decades. These games offer distinct advantages to the lottery authorities and are attractive to a broad spectrum of players. Typically, the tickets are printed in the primary language of a targeted population base. For example, the same themed ticket may be printed in different runs in English, Spanish, German, and so forth, depending on the intended country or other distribution locale.
However, as the population base grows more culturally diverse, particularly in larger metropolitan areas, one single language may no longer be dominant over a broad population spectrum. Entire sections or neighborhoods of a city or other locale may speak one language, while an adjacent neighborhood primarily speaks an entirely different language. The residents of these neighborhoods may not be comfortable with the other respective language. This pertains to play of lottery tickets in differing languages as well. Persons who are not fluent or comfortable with the language of the scratch-off (“instant”) lottery ticket may avoid playing the game for fear of not understanding the game rules or, even worse, not recognizing that their ticket may actually be a winning ticket. As the games continue to add greater prizes and more complex entertainment features, the reluctance to play by those not comfortable with the language of the ticket will correspondingly grow.
In the past, it has not been economically or commercially feasible to provide a multi-lingual game card or lottery ticket. The available surface area on a scratch-off ticket (often referred to as the ticket “real estate”) for the various game features, such as a game play area, instructions, security features, graphics, and so forth, is limited and cannot reasonably accommodate repetition of the pertinent game rules or instructions in different languages. Essentially, the only option was to provide separate production runs of tickets in the different languages.
U.S. Pat. No. 8,434,792 proposes a solution wherein a game on a single paper game card includes a game play area, and a first set of game instructions provided on the game card printed in a first language. A second set of the game instructions in a different second printed language is superimposed over the first set of game instructions. An indicator is provided on the game card to convey that the first set of game instructions are present and accessible by removing the second set of game instructions. Thus, the player has the option to read the game instructions in either or both of the first or second printed languages. Although this is a useful method and system, it requires substantial additional printing time, expenses, and materials.
The industry and public would benefit from still more improved methods to facilitate multi-lingual play of a game on a printed game card, such as a scratch-off lottery ticket.

In a particular embodiment, an instant lottery ticket game system and method includes a set of master instant lottery tickets (“master tickets”) for a common game. The master instant lottery tickets may be printed paper tickets, or may be electronically simulated tickets that are transmitted to and played by the player via an application running on a smart device, such as a mobile phone, tablet, computer, etc. The master tickets are produced for a single common game, for example all of the tickets produced for a common game identified by a single name (e.g., “Lucky Seven” instant scratch-off tickets). Such tickets may be produced under multiple production runs, wherein the prize structure for the expected value of the common game is implemented by winning tickets distributed throughout the production run(s).
Each master ticket includes a game play area with variable game play indicia that determines whether or not the ticket is a winning or losing ticket. The game play indicia is variable in that it changes from one ticket to the next. The game play area is covered by a removable scratch-off coating (SOC) layer, as is well-known in the industry. Each master ticket also includes static game instruction indicia (words and graphics) that does not change and is common to all of the master tickets in the common game. This indicia generally instructs the player on how to play the game, the potential prizes, and so forth. At least some or all of the game instruction indicia is in a master language, for example English.
Each of the master tickets further includes a code thereon that links the master ticket to the common game in a database. For example, all of the master tickets in the same common game will have the same code (which may encompass the same part or identifying information in a ticket-specific code, such as a validation code).
For each common game, one or more corresponding digital templates are produced and stored in a computer-accessible file, wherein each digital template contains the static game instruction indicia in a foreign language. For example, a respective digital template may be produced and stored in Spanish, French, German, and so forth.
It should be appreciated that the term “master language” in used herein to refer to the language of the primary printed or electronic ticket master ticket, and is not limited to any particular language. The term “foreign language” is used herein to refer to any language that is different than the master language.
A central server initially stores the digital templates for the common game, and is configured for communication with a player's smart device to download the digital templates via an application running on the player's smart device. In one embodiment, the digital templates for one or more of the common games are downloaded and stored on the player's smart device before the player even purchases a master ticket. For example, the digital templates may be downloaded to the player's smart device with the application. Upon entry of the code from the master ticket into the smart device, the application makes the stored digital templates available.
In an alternate embodiment, the digital templates are not downloaded and stored in the player's smart device, but are individually transmitted by the central server to the smart device upon receipt of the code from the smart device.
With the above system and method, the player enters (scans or otherwise inputs) the code from the master ticket into their smart device via the application on the device. The player is then provided with the option to select one of the digital templates stored on their smart device to view the game instruction indicia in the foreign language of the digital template.
In a particular embodiment, the digital templates are presented on the player's smart device as static non-interactive images. In other words, the player does not interact with the images in order to play the game or otherwise reveal the outcome of the game. With this embodiment, the digital templates may be presented as part of a generic instant lottery ticket image for the common game. For example, the digital template may be combined with a generic game play area to represent a complete ticket.
The code on each master ticket may serve only as a game-specific code for the common game, and not be specific to individual master instant lottery tickets within the common game. However, each master ticket may also include a separate ticket-specific code, such as a validation code that is linked to a validation file associated with the master ticket at the central server. As generally understood in the industry, the validation file contains ticket-specific information for validation and pay-out (redemption) of the master ticket.
In still another embodiment, the code can also be a ticket-specific code that also links the master instant lottery ticket to a ticket-specific file at the central server. For example, such a code may contain the common game identification data and the ticket specific data. A validation code (or modified validation code) may serve this function. The ticket-specific file can include a digital game play area corresponding to the game play area on the master ticket, wherein upon receipt of the ticket-specific code, the central server transmits the digital game play area to the player's smart device where the digital game play area is combined with the digital template and presented to the player as a complete digital counterpart to the master ticket. With this embodiment, the digital game play area may interactive, wherein the application on the player's smart device may also enable simulated play (e.g., simulated removal of a digital SOC layer) of the digital ticket on the smart device to reveal the winning or losing status of the master ticket. This embodiment is also particularly useful when some or all of the variable game play indicia on the master instant lottery ticket is in the master language. The digital game play area can include such indicia in the foreign language selected by the player.
In the above embodiment, the ticket-specific code may be the ticket validation code that is also linked to a validation file associated with the master ticket at the central server, wherein the digital game play areas are stored in the validation file.
The system and method also contemplate that each of the master instant lottery tickets is specifically configured to include an easily recognized symbol printed thereon that indicates to players that one or more of the foreign language digital lottery tickets is available for the master instant lottery ticket. For example, such symbol may be a multi-national caricature, similar to the Olympic Games characters and mascots.

At step 102, the master language tickets 14 are produced with the code 22 and multi-language enabled symbol 46 provided thereon.
Step 104 depicts generation of the foreign language digital templates 26, which are initially stored at the central server 50.
At step 106, the player purchases one or more of the master tickets 14 (paper or electronic).
At step 108, the player scans or otherwise enters the code 22 from the master ticket 14 into their smart device 34 via the application running on the smart device 34. At this time, the foreign-language digital template options are presented to the player via the smart device 34
At step 110, via the application running on the smart device 34, the player is presented with the digital template in foreign-language selected by the player, which may be combined with a generic game play area.
At step 112, the player plays the master ticket 14 with reference to the foreign-language game play instructions provided by the digital template on their smart device.
Step 114 depicts that the player presents the master ticket 14 for validation and redemption of a winning master ticket 14.
At step 202, the master language tickets 14 are produced with the ticket-specific code 42 and multi-language enabled symbol 46 provided thereon.
Step 204 depicts generation of the foreign language digital templates 26, which are initially stored at the central server 50.
Step 206 depicts generation of the foreign-language digital game play areas that are unique to each master ticket 14 and are stored in a ticket-specific file (e.g. the validation file) at the central server 50.
At step 208, the player purchases one or more of the master tickets 14 (paper or electronic).
At step 210, the player scans or otherwise enters the ticket-specific code 42 from the master ticket 14 into their smart device 34 via the application running on the smart device 34 and is presented with the foreign-language digital template options.
At step 212, the foreign-language digital template 26 selected by the player is provided to the mobile application from the digital templates 26 stored on the smart device 34 or individually transmitted by the central server 50.
At step 214, the digital game play area 30 corresponding to the foreign language digital template 26 selected by the player is retrieved by the central server 50 from the ticket-specific file 38 (e.g., the validation file) and downloaded to the player's mobile smart device 34.
At step 216, the mobile smart device 34 combines the digital template 26 and corresponding digital game play area 30 into an interactive digital ticket image of the master ticket 14.
At step 218, the player has the option simulate play of the digital ticket image on their mobile smart device 34 to reveal the predetermined outcome of the master ticket 14.
Alternatively, at step 220, the player can simply play the master ticket 14 with reference to the foreign language game play instructions 28 provided by the digital ticket image on their smart device.
At step 222, the player presents the actual master ticket 14 or the digital ticket image on their smart device for validation and redemption of winning master tickets 14.
